Q & A: Air-Bag Specs

Originally Published in MotorHome Magazine

Q. We have air bags in the front suspension of our motorhome on a GM
P-chassis. We can’t find inflation specifications. Can you help?

 

A. As per
Firestone specifications for air bags on P-30 chassis, it calls for a maximum of 60 psi and
a 30 psi minimum in front. If it has rear air bags, use 90 psi maximum/10 psi minimum.
